Output 18625153d84585b351a234be07121f4fea797671e2765ec5b7050580db3e1168: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2935b09680469b51281b376f87c592e0ed0a46 OP_EQUAL
address
3HCkATTABvFu8uLmozBkuuN6ZkmtViysAe
transaction
18625153d84585b351a234be07121f4fea797671e2765ec5b7050580db3e1168
spent
true